The play tells the story of Warren, who after stealing $15 000 from his criminal father, hides out at his friend Dennis’ house. Written by Kenneth Lonergan, This Is Our Youth is modern warhorse of a script, that- along with critical acclaim- has seen many big name actors tackle its meaty limbs of theme and emotion. The current production features Sean Gilchrist, Andrew Baker, and Sydney Cochrane and is directed by none other than Robert James Woolsey.
